Factionalism in BJP worries supporters | | | EARLY TIMES REPORT Jammu, Feb 19 :-BJP supporters and workers continue to be worried over the growing factional feuds within the party's state unit. Replying a question a senior BJP leader said: "the state unit of the BJP has more factions than the state unit of the Congress." Explaining it he said that the congress in Jammu and Kahmir was divided mainly between the two factions, one owing loyalty to Saif-ud-Din Soz, and the other to the Union Health Minister, Ghulam Nabi Azad but the state unit of the BJP was divided in four group. He said in fact the party had four groups, one led by Professor Chaman Lal Gupta, one by Dr Nirmal Singh and the third by President Shamsher Singh and so on. The BJP leader said that entry of Dr Jitendra Singh, prominent dermatologist and a columnist, in the party should have proved an asset or the BJP in the state but one group owing allegiance to Shamsher Singh was trying to indulge in leg pulling. He said in the interest of party unity and strength Dr Singh should be encouraged and helped to play a dominant role in the organisation. The leader wanted the party high command to intervene and bring about reconciliation among the different factions failing which whatever gains the party had achieved in the 2008 Assembly poll, when it won 11 seats against one in 2002 election, would be frittered way in due course of time. He also favoured a free hand to Professor Chaman Lal Gupta in framing the future course of action for the party for exposing various omissions and commissions of the ruling coalition in the state. Other leaders said that unit in the party was called for so that it could wage an effective campaign against regional discrimination which had deprived people of the regions of Jammu and Ladakh political empowerment and equal devolution of financial powers. The party was supposed to fight for setting up fresh delimitation commission so that the region of Jammu had as many Assembly segments as the Kashmir valley had
